I should think that you could bolt an Argentinian head to any small 6 and build whatever engine you choose. The Argentinian head is aluminum (if I recall correctly) so it dissipates heat better and you can run higher compression than a cast iron head. It also flows better and has bigger valves and all that good stuff. You can still choose whatever camshaft you like and pistons, etc…
